Finding the Best Other Multi/Interdisciplinary Studies Bachelor's Degree School for You

Other Multi/Interdisciplinary Studies is the #33 most popular major in the country with 34,975 degrees and certificates awarded in 2020-2021.

It's not easy to decide which program to enroll in when you have so many options available. You can choose a traditional brick and mortar school, or with the growth of online education, you can attend a school half-way across the country without even leaving your house. Also there are many trade schools that offer short-term programs that open up more career options.

To help you arm yourself with the information you need to make your decision, Course Advisor has developed this Most Popular Other Interdisciplinary Studies Bachelor's Degree Schools ranking. Our analysis looked at 609 schools in the United States to see which bachelor's degree programs were the most popular for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Other Multi/Interdisciplinary Studies program at each school on the list.

The colleges and universities below are the most popular for other interdisciplinary studies majors pursuing a bachelor's degree.

Liberty University

Lynchburg, VA

Our 2023 rankings named Liberty University the most popular school in the United States for other multi/interdisciplinary studies students working on their bachelor’s degree. Located in the small city of Lynchburg, Liberty University is a private not-for-profit college with a very large student population.

Of the 1,502 students majoring in other interdisciplinary studies at Liberty University, 46% are male and 54% are female.

On average, other interdisciplinary studies graduates from Liberty University take out $31,170 in student loans while working on their Bachelor's Degree. The average monthly payment of a loan this size is about $268, assuming that the borrower is on a 10-year repayment plan.
